The centre boasts a diverse array of exhibits that highlight both contemporary and traditional crafts. Visitors can explore stunning displays of pottery, textiles, jewelry, and more, all crafted by talented local artisans. The centre’s gallery and shop feature over 75 Cape Breton artists, providing a unique opportunity to purchase one-of-a-kind pieces. Additionally, the centre hosts rotating exhibitions and special events that showcase the evolving craft scene on the island.
Beyond its exhibits, the Cape Breton Centre for Craft and Design offers a variety of educational programs. From hands-on workshops to artist talks, these programs are designed to engage and inspire visitors. The centre also supports the local craft community through its Artisan Incubator, which helps emerging artists develop their skills and grow their businesses.
The Cape Breton Centre for Craft and Design is situated at 322 Charlotte St, Sydney, NS B1P 1C8. Easily accessible by car, the centre offers ample parking nearby.
